How-To Change & Reset Password
This tutorial will show you 3 different ways on how to change and reset passwords.
From Log-In Screen
* Note: to use this feature your email address must be listed on your User Detail page in CMS.
On the Log-In Screen after you have entered your Site Code there is a link “Forgot your username or password”, which when clicked will prompt you to enter in your email address.
Click the link you need (Username or Password)

If your email address is listed on your User Detail Page, you will receive email which will show your username:
or a link to reset your password:
Change Password while logged into CMS
While logged in to CMS click on your name in upper right corner to open your User Profile and click Change Password in the Summary panel.
On pop up screen enter Current Password, New Password and Confirmation New Password and click Update Password.
Change Password from User Detail Page
*Note: You must have access to the Admin Console > User Management > Users to perform this change.
First login to you CMS page and click the “App Selector” button at the top, right corner of the screen and open the Admin Console
, this will open the Home page of the Admin Console.
Next, under the User Management group, click the “Users” option.
Click pencil next to User’s name to open the Edit User page.
Scroll down the page to the “Reset Actions” panel on the right side and click Reset Password.
All password resets will immediately reset the User’s password and will not be able to log in without using the new password.
